How to watch today's Colombia U20 vs South Africa U20 World Cup game: Live stream, TV channel, and start time

Africa's U20 champions, South Africa, are brimming with belief as they gear up for a knockout clash against Colombia U20 at the 2025 U20 World Cup

The young Bafana booked their ticket to the round of 16 after a hard-fought second-place finish in Group E, while Colombia marched through as Group F winners.

For the South Americans, this is familiar territory; their best showing came back in 2003 when they claimed a bronze medal. Yet, despite topping their group, Colombia never truly caught fire in the group stage, managing two draws and a narrow 1-0 win over Saudi Arabia. Their final match against Nigeria ended in heartbreak as they conceded late to settle for a 1-1 draw, extending their unbeaten streak to seven but leaving questions about their cutting edge.

South Africa, meanwhile, have shown plenty of grit and growth since a tough opening loss to France. They bounced back emphatically, thrashing New Caledonia 5-0 before producing one of the tournament’s shock results, a gutsy 2-1 comeback victory over USA U20 to seal second place.

Colombia U20 vs South Africa U20 kick-off time

The World Cup U20 round of 16 match between Colombia U20 and South Africa U20 will be played at Estadio Fiscal de Talca in Talca, Chile.

It will kick off at 12:30 pm PT / 3:30 pm ET on Wednesday, October 8, in the US.

Colombia U20 team news

The South Americans topped Group F with five points, grinding out a win and two draws, though their campaign so far has followed a familiar script. Each of their opponents sat deep in a compact low block, frustrating Cesar Torres's side and forcing them to labor through packed defenses. Unable to fully impose their technical superiority, Colombia were often dragged into physical battles, a trade that stifled their rhythm and creativity. The end result? Just two goals in three outings, the joint-lowest tally among all teams advancing to the round of 16, tied with Norway.

Still, Torres, ever the animated figure on the touchline, has urged his side to keep their foot on the gas, demanding more urgency and bravery in the final third. Gonzalez, operating as a relentless box-to-box midfielder, has been vital with his surging runs into the penalty area, while Oscar Perea remains Colombia's most potent spark in attack. Now, the spotlight could soon turn to Neiser Villarreal, the bright young playmaker who provided the assist for Gonzalez's strike against Nigeria

South Africa U20 team news

Mfundo Vilakazi, the creative spark from Kaizer Chiefs, once again showcased his class, pulling the strings with his sharp vision and inventive passing. It was his clever through ball that set the wheels in motion for the game-winning goal, underlining why he's one of South Africa's brightest young playmakers.

In midfield, Gomolemo Kekana, already earning minutes with Mamelodi Sundowns' senior side, ran the show with remarkable poise and authority. His ability to dictate tempo and outmuscle older opponents belied his age, stamping his influence all over the contest.

At the back, Fletcher Smythe-Lowe, the Estoril-based shot-stopper, was immense between the sticks. He pulled off six crucial saves and marshalled his area with composure well beyond his years, keeping the Americans at bay when the pressure mounted.

Even when Amajita spent long stretches without the ball, their backline, anchored by the steady Tylon Smith, stood tall, limiting the USA to half-chances and frustrating their forwards into submission.
